Starting from today, we will begin a series of courses on HTML5 canvas. This series is my summary after reading HTML5 canvas: Native interactivity and animation for the Web. If you are interested, you can download the original English books and read them. This book introduces canvas game development to show us the powerful functions of
1.Canvas CanvasCanvas class canvas encapsulates such things as graphics and picture drawing, and these commonly used functions are described below:Drawcolor (int color)Effect: Draw color overlay canvas, often used for brush screenParameters: Color values, also available in 16-in-form notation (ARGB)DrawText (String text,float x,float y,paint Paint)Function: Draw
Simple getting started canvas, Getting Started canvas
I. Preface
I have been working on front-end PC development, from the Internet to industrial software. Recently, I found that mobile terminals have become essential front-end skills and cannot stop learning. Some new things added to HTML5, canvas is a relatively complicated one. It's easy to get started and lea
The rain animation produced by Canvas and the rain animation by canvas
Introduction
It is interesting to see a Canvas rain effect animation on codepen. I have studied it. Here I will share my implementation skills.
Effect:
Canvas animation Basics
As we all know, Canvas is a
When we resize the canvas, we want the drawing in the canvas to stay the same, just to change the size of the canvas itself. However, if you use CSS to set the canvas size, the problem occurs.
Problem description
Setting the size of the canvas
Canvas basic learning (3): canvas basic learning
I. image loading controls
Multiple images are often used in canvas effect creation. To improve the user experience, you need to provide users with excessive page effects during image loading. I used Sonic. js in the project, and its address on git is. Is:
The call code is also relatively simple.
The following is
Canvas implements the matrix of black guest empire Rectangles and canvas black guest empire rectangles
In the blog Park, I saw che da bang and wrote an article about implementing the matrix of the matrix. I think canvas still has some wonderful places, so I should take a note to record it.
The implementation result is as follows:
It is really one or two lines of
A summary of the methods of the Paint and Canvas classes in Android, canvas in Android
Common Methods of the Paint class
1. The setColor method is used to set the color of the paint brush,Public void setColor (int color) // The color parameter is the Color value. You can also use the color defined by the color class.Color. BLACK: BLACKColor. BLUE: BLUEColor. CYAN: GreenColor. DKGRAY: Gray-blackColor. YELLOW
Article Introduction: are you still complaining that your canvas demo is hovering below 10 frames? Are you still bothering to open your own writing application and hear the cup fan turn? Are you writing a JavaScript canvas library? So here are nine points you need to know!
Are you still complaining that your canvas demo is hovering below 10 frames? Ar
Detailed description of the canvas-based video mask plug-in, detailed description of the canvas mask
Adds a cover for a video to block a video area. During a certain video period, for example, the area between 10th and 20th minutes is not displayed. Application scenarios include hiding TV icons, blocking advertisements in the lower right corner of the video, and acting as mosaic.
A long video may contain mu
Actually, canvas is really simple. The complicated part is actually your creativity, canvas creativity.
In addition to the "H5" of the ox cross, the canvas application of the ox cross is also spread across the rivers and lakes.
Canvas is a part of html5. Of course, H5 is not the meaning of html5. It just means that in
Processing.js
Processing.js is an open programming language that enables program images, animations, and interactive applications without the use of Flash or Java applets. Processing.js is a lightweight, easy to understand, ideal tool for visualizing data, creating user interfaces, and developing web-based games.
FABRIC. Js
FABRIC. JS is a simple and powerful JavaScript Canvas library that provides an interactive object model while also containing
Just a sunny day, this is not a will be cloudy, rain, eyes on the down, a cold autumn rain, feel know to wear the rhythm of the cotton-padded jacketBefore October 1, or T-shirt, October after the national day and the Mid-Autumn festival began to sweater, sweaters, fur coats, it is really 8 days after a season AH ~ ~ ~Maybe the autumn in the north is so fast.Keep looking at canvas's rotate () methodRotate () rotates the current drawing.Syntax: context.rotate (angle)Parameters: Angle rotation angl
Note: This article is translated from:Http://developer.android.com/guide/topics/graphics/2d-graphics.html
Drawing on a view object
If the applicationProgramThere is no need for a large amount of graphic processing or a high frame rate (such as a chess game, Snake game, or another slow animation application), you should consider creating a custom view component, and use the view of this component. the canvas parameter of the ondraw () method to dra
of the Settings menu is set to the child item ID separately. Instead of the master item. The item does not need an ID.3, because a moment also to the user to draw out the picture of the SDcard card, so will apply in the Androidmanifest.xml sdcard Write permission:4. Create a new view of your own definition, like the "Android" definition view, canvas canvas and brush paint (click to open link). This is Draw
Use canvas to draw a Doraemon clock, canvas Doraemon
I am so happy to have read the canvas of the Js book today ~ It's also a beloved canvas ~ Ouye ~
I was advised to draw a blue fat man before. Yes, how can I forget my childhood favorite blue fat man? To express my apologies for the blue fat man, so today I drew the d
previously used Canvas when drawing, they are directly in the Canvas The label directly written on the width of the high, no problem, but also did not explore why the width of the directly written in Canvas tag, because it's written in every case of data. Today, Mr Wang raises a question: If you write the width and height in 1. Width: 400, High: 300, direct writ
;(function ($) {$. Loading = function (options) {Burst plug-in default value$. Loading.defaults = {Speed:200,//eject Layer fade-out SpeedBgcolor: ' Rgba (0,0,0,.7) ',//mask layer color, requires RGBA format, default black 0.5 transparencyType: html,//default HTML style, or canvasMsg: ' Loading ... ',//default loading informationLoadpicnum:2,//for HTML when loading picture which kind;Canvassupport:false,//whether support HTML5 CanvasLoadtimer:3000,//mask layer hidden time, only valid in HTML form
To give you illustrator software users to detailed analysis of the canvas size to share the adjustment tutorial.
Tutorial Sharing:
Method One:
1. If we don't have a new canvas, we can set the size we want before creating a new canvas.
2, open the AI software, execute the file in the menu bar-new, or directly pre
Canvas is a container control that is used to locate1. Basic applicationsYou can compare a canvas to a coordinate system , and all the elements determine their position in the coordinate system by setting the coordinates . The origin of this coordinate system is not in the center , but in its upper-left corner . See There are four ways to set the coordinates of an element:Canvas.Top set the distance of e
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.